Running a Newsletter + Funnel Business From One Tool: An Honest Look at systeme.io
Most creators don't start with one tool — they start with five: an email platform, a landing-page builder, a course host, a checkout processor, and something to glue it all together. Each one is $20–$50/month on its own, and none of them talk to each other cleanly. systeme.io is the tool we point people to when that pile of subscriptions has become the actual problem. It bundles email/newsletters, sales funnels, course hosting, a blog, and checkout into one dashboard — so this isn't a roundup written from a spec sheet, it's the answer to "what do I actually need to start" for a solopreneur running lean.
The one-line version: systeme.io trades some of the polish of a best-in-class specialist tool (a dedicated email platform, a dedicated course platform) for the simplicity of running your whole business from one login, one price, and one place your data lives. That's the reason to pick it — and, if you already love your current email tool or funnel builder, also the reason it might feel like a step sideways rather than up.

What systeme.io does well
- A genuinely usable free plan. You can build a funnel, send email, and publish a course before you pay anything — the free tier isn't a crippled demo, it's a real starting point.
- Everything under one login. Email newsletters, landing pages, sales funnels, a course/membership area, a blog, and affiliate management for your own products all live in the same dashboard. No Zapier duct tape required just to get your welcome sequence to trigger after a purchase.
- One flat price instead of a stack. Instead of paying separately for ConvertKit-or-similar + a funnel builder + a course host, you pay one systeme.io bill. For a lean, early-stage creator that's real money back in the business.
- Built for selling, not just publishing. Checkout, order bumps, upsells, and affiliate tracking for your own products are native — it's built by and for people trying to make money from an audience, not just grow a list.
Where it can frustrate you (the honest part)
- No individual piece is the best in its category. The email editor won't out-design a dedicated newsletter platform, and the course player is simpler than a dedicated course platform. You're trading specialist polish for breadth and price.
- Migrating in takes a weekend, not an afternoon. If you already have an email list, a funnel, and a course living in three different tools, consolidating into one takes real setup time — it's worth it, but don't expect to do it in an hour.
- The design ceiling is lower than a dedicated page builder. If pixel-perfect custom design is non-negotiable for your brand, a specialist landing-page tool will still out-flex it.

- Is systeme.io really free to start?
- Yes — there's a genuine free plan with no credit card required, covering a funnel, email, and a course. Paid plans unlock higher contact/funnel limits and remove systeme.io branding; check the current pricing page for exact thresholds.
- Do I need to already have an audience before it's worth it?
- No. Because the free plan covers the whole stack (funnel + email + course), systeme.io is arguably most useful before you have an audience — it's how you build the first funnel and list without five separate subscriptions eating your runway.
- Is systeme.io better than running separate best-in-class tools?
- Different bets. A best-in-class stack (dedicated email tool + dedicated funnel builder + dedicated course host) gives you more polish in each piece, at a higher combined price and more moving parts to maintain. systeme.io trades some of that polish for one login, one bill, and everything already talking to everything else. For a solopreneur running lean, that trade is usually worth it.
